KAREN THURMAN (D) District 5

BORN: Jan. 12, 1951, Rapid City, S. Dak. EDUCATION: Santa Fe Community College, A.A., 1971; U of Florida, B.A., 1973 FAMILY: Husband, John; two children RELIGION: Episcopalian MILITARY: None OCCUPATION: Teacher POLITICAL CAREER: Dunnellon city council, 1975-83, mayor, 1979-81; Florida Senate, 1983-92; U.S. House, 1992- ADDRESS: P.O. Box 5058, Inverness 34453. Tel.: 352-344-4977

Thurman represents a diverse district, including the University of Florida, two nuclear power plants and acres of citrus plantations. More conservative fiscally than socially, she sponsored a federal bill to reimburse Florida for the cost of imprisoning criminal illegal immigrants, but opposed mandatory parental notification of minors' abortions. She also pushed for hearings on the link between Agent Orange and birth defects.

NEWELL O'BRIEN (D) District 6 (North central--Lake, Baker and Marion counties; part of Jacksonville)

BORN: Aug. 25, 1938, Augusta, Maine EDUCATION: Jones College, A.S., 1974 FAMILY: Wife, Jean; four children RELIGION: Roman Catholic MILITARY: Navy, 1955-59 OCCUPATION: Aircraft examination director; aircraft mechanic POLITICAL CAREER: None ADDRESS: 308 Linden Lane, Orange Park 32073. Tel.: 904-264-9608

O'Brien, who went from blue-collar to management in a 36-year aircraft-mechanic career, wants to use his experience to "unlock the deadlock" in Congress. He doesn't want to become a power broker, but is just "an average citizen...upset with the state of our government." O'Brien says he won't take campaign funds from big corporations and wants to bring true representation back to Washington.
